Honda Motor(HMC) - 2026 Q3 - Earnings Call Transcript
2026-02-10 09:02
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The operating profit for the third quarter was JPY 591.5 billion, achieving record high unit sales, operating profit, and operating margin [2][4] - Operating cash flow after R&D adjustment was JPY 1,855.8 billion, consistent with the same period last year [3] - The forecast for operating profit for the fiscal year ending March 2026 remains at JPY 550 billion, with profit for the year also unchanged at JPY 300 billion [3][5] Business Segment Data and Key Metrics Changes - Motorcycle operations achieved cumulative sales of 16.44 million units, driven by strong sales in India, Pakistan, and Brazil [7] - Automobile operations reported sales of 2.561 million units, reflecting a decline primarily due to semiconductor shortages [7] - The power products business sold 2.507 million units, with mixed results across regions [7]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The competitive environment for automobiles in Asia is expected to intensify, necessitating increased incentives [3] - The impact from tariffs was initially forecasted at JPY 450 billion but has been revised down to JPY 310 billion [3][5] - The exchange rate against the U.S. dollar is assumed at 140 JPY for the full-year period, with potential upside from yen depreciation [5][12]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company aims to build flexible business characteristics to adapt to changing environments and enhance product features and cost competitiveness [15][16] - A fundamental review of strategies is underway to rebuild competitive strength in light of stagnated EV market growth and intensified competition from emerging OEMs [14][15] - The company is focusing on launching next-generation hybrid systems and enhancing the earning capability of hybrid models [15]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management acknowledged challenges such as stagnated EV market growth, less stringent environmental regulations, and heightened supply chain risks [14] - The company is maintaining its forecast despite uncertainties in the business environment, indicating cautious optimism for the fourth quarter [3][28] - Management emphasized the need for disciplined expenditure control and a review of capital expenditure plans aligned with market conditions [15][28] Other Important Information - The board of directors approved the cancellation of 747 million treasury stocks [6] - The company has adopted a DOE indicator to ensure stable returns and dividends aligned with growth, even in volatile environments [16] Q&A Session All Questions and Answers Question: Full year outlook and automobile profitability - Management indicated that while expenses are expected to increase in the fourth quarter, the overall outlook remains unchanged, with a focus on managing BEV-related costs and incentives [21][25][28] Question: EV market trends and strategy - Management acknowledged the need to revisit EV strategies due to negative demand environments and competition from local manufacturers in China [31][33] Question: Tariff impact and sales situation - Management explained that tariff impacts have decreased from initial forecasts, with recovery plans in place to mitigate costs [43][45][46] Question: Rare earth metals supply concerns - Management confirmed reliance on China for rare earth metals and emphasized the need for timely export applications and inventory management [50][52] Question: Collaboration with other companies - Management stated that while discussions with Nissan continue, they are open to exploring collaborations with other companies to reduce development costs [56][62]
